Understanding Koval's Decision

In recent interviews, Koval cited a variety of personal and professional reasons for her choice to leave the program. She expressed her desire for more playing time and a suitable environment where she could thrive. The dynamics of college basketball have changed significantly, with increased pressure on athletes to perform while also balancing academic commitments.

A Growing Trend in College Sports

The increasing number of players transferring between programs has become a notable trend in the NCAA. According to the NCAA's latest reports, transfer rates have reached an all-time high, suggesting that athletes are actively seeking better opportunities. Koval's departure from LSU aligns with this pattern, demonstrating the evolving landscape of college athletics.
